Type
ORACLE
Validation date
2025-03-16 11:37: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00454,
    "usd": 0.00496
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000108F304DA268B061563982159D971B9650DE469CEBD00915A688197FBCDEB6FC5

Previous signature

8F3811ABB38E570DB5F3F957F2E7DFC1DB9B3874DAAB2A4E0CCA466818B9C3113B95E643FAF4F6B230478068E06D45F455C399BAD91102DACDE76D68548B9303

Origin signature

3045022100AB285505C7C4DCB7940B4D2379E5415375C97196712319B9F2838FCD87525819022025161B8EBCEC9D8E884095A37B5B77FA1E300DA630E2AB1075EBD9FF0A58307F

Proof of work

010204159AB302F5715034C8A79FD439712490A5162FD3637E2BE87EE8F910D193E31B71FBA34176C5D4A89BABA095A3D7B2553F01A963C1E9402222FA07A37BE54AC5

Proof of integrity

005AC665C19E31EEB085E553F13B99390D314FE0B5728EA4DA8F62578FA1D8296E

Coordinator signature

58EAAC8EA5C533D5A10247EB1263730A96AC08D8C47101AACEAC036410030CBC7DA8F897E59D82695AEF288C0DB6DB1FE0C79B396C17332656E168D89C2AA001

Validator #1 public key

00011518CD02E2B0009F828843512538A3F44A9CB493EB5E288376E4E45AD727AB3E

Validator #1 signature

E9FFB5250D3AE21156C7D4C8CFF54F6BAF40FA4E1AAC875A6B8D9D50A7B2D8D522A26423C788C96B400C5CF12F73A71FD7F1E9DEA66DC8055A4B2EA67C209808

Validator #2 public key

000135EC3C0E5BE772F06D14C70F6F19C9162D8E1C37321175F8EA490ED1960D487B

Validator #2 signature

65E85450CD7860C17B5043C1F2EB25644286F91EAB27E38BE34123D4292C2EADA9337134BCE9B06E04336302A012280417467237F9336533B03A86D0D3019D0B